The Core Objectives Explained
Understanding Facebook ad objectives is essential for effective marketing. Each objective serves a unique purpose. Choose the right one to meet your business goals.
Awareness: Building Brand Visibility
The Awareness objective focuses on making more people aware of your brand. This is vital for new businesses or products. Here are key points:
- Increases brand recognition.
- Targets a broad audience.
- Creates interest in your offerings.
Ads may include:
- Video ads showcasing your brand story.
- Image ads highlighting key products.
Consideration: Engaging Potential Customers
The Consideration objective aims to engage users. It encourages them to learn more about your business. Important aspects include:
- Leads to higher engagement rates.
- Encourages users to visit your website.
- Promotes interaction through likes and shares.
Types of ads may involve:
- Content that sparks curiosity.
- Polls or quizzes to encourage interaction.
Conversion: Encouraging Specific Actions
The Conversion objective drives users to take specific actions. This can include purchases, sign-ups, or app downloads. Key elements are:
- Targets users ready to act.
- Focuses on measurable outcomes.
- Offers incentives like discounts.
Effective ad types might include:
- Product ads with clear call-to-action buttons.
- Limited-time offers to create urgency.
| Objective | Focus | Key Actions |
|---|---|---|
| Awareness | Brand visibility | Increases recognition |
| Consideration | User engagement | Encourages website visits |
| Conversion | Specific actions | Drives purchases |

Strategies To Choose The Correct Objective
Choosing the right Facebook ad objective is crucial for success. Each objective serves a different purpose. Understanding your goals helps direct your strategy.
Assessing Your Marketing Funnel
Identify where your audience is in the marketing funnel. The funnel has three main stages:
- Aware: People know your brand.
- Consideration: People are interested in your products.
- Conversion: People are ready to buy.
Choose objectives based on these stages:
| Funnel Stage | Recommended Objective |
|---|---|
| Aware | Brand Awareness |
| Consideration | Traffic or Engagement |
| Conversion | Conversions |
Aligning Business Goals With Ad Objectives
Your business goals should guide your ad objectives. Define what you want to achieve:
- Increase sales: Focus on conversion objectives.
- Boost website traffic: Select traffic objectives.
- Grow brand awareness: Choose brand awareness objectives.
Ensure your chosen objectives match your business goals. This alignment enhances your ad performance.

Optimizing Campaigns For Your Chosen Objective
Optimizing your Facebook ad campaigns is crucial. Choose the right objective to reach your goals. Each objective focuses on different results. Understanding these objectives helps in making smart choices. Let’s explore how to enhance your campaigns effectively.
A/b Testing Essentials
A/B testing is a powerful tool. It helps you compare two versions of an ad. Use it to find which version performs better.
- Test different images.
- Change headlines to see what grabs attention.
- Experiment with calls-to-action.
Follow these steps for effective A/B testing:
- Choose one variable to test.
- Run the ads simultaneously.
- Monitor results closely.
- Analyze data after a set period.
Analyzing And Adjusting
Analyzing your campaign data is vital. Look at key metrics like:
| Metric | Description |
|---|---|
| CTR | Click-through rate shows ad engagement. |
| Conversions | Measure how many users completed your goal. |
| CPC | Cost per click tells you how much you spend. |
Adjust your campaigns based on this data. Increase budget for high-performing ads. Pause or change ads that underperform.
Regular adjustments lead to better results. Keep testing and refining your strategy for success.
